Businesses today face a pivotal decision: outsource their SEO or build an in-house team. Each path carries distinct advantages and trade-offs that affect visibility, cost, and growth. This article compares both approaches—covering effectiveness, cost, and operational flexibility—so you can choose the right SEO solution for your business, and closes with the pros, cons, and key factors that should shape your decision.

Outsourcing SEO Services vs. In-House SEO Teams: A Comprehensive Analysis

Deciding between outsourcing SEO and building an in-house team requires understanding what each option entails. Outsourcing often provides access to a broader range of expertise and the latest tools, while in-house teams tend to align more closely with business goals thanks to their intimate knowledge of company culture and products.

SEO effectiveness ultimately depends on strategy and execution, regardless of approach. Companies should weigh budget, expertise, and marketing goals when deciding. Engaging a reputable agency is often a faster route to implementing effective SEO strategies than training a brand-new in-house team.

Pros and Cons of Each Approach

Comparison of agency team working on SEO versus in-house team discussing strategies

Outsourcing SEO Services (Full Stack and Boutique Agencies)

Pros:

  1. Access to Expertise: Diverse, high-level expertise that can enhance campaign performance.
  2. Cost-Effective: Often more budget-friendly than a full-time in-house team.
  3. Scalability: Agencies can quickly scale services to match changing needs.

Cons:

  1. Less Control: Less oversight over the work being done.
  2. Communication Barriers: Time zone differences can complicate communication.
  3. Variable Quality: Service quality varies significantly between agencies.

In-House SEO Teams

Pros:

  1. Alignment with Goals: Tightly aligned with business objectives and culture.
  2. Immediate Availability: Faster changes and strategy updates.
  3. Enhanced Communication: Easier flow since team members work closely together.

Cons:

  1. Higher Overheads: Salaries and benefits raise overall costs.
  2. Scalability Issues: Harder to resize the team as demand fluctuates.
  3. Limited Expertise: May lack exposure to varied approaches without ongoing training.

Key Factors to Consider When Selecting an SEO Solution

Checklist and tools representing key factors in selecting an SEO solution

Choosing the right SEO solution means evaluating budget flexibility, operational bandwidth, and how much senior strategy involvement your SEO planning needs.

Budget: A restricted budget often favors outsourcing, since it typically requires a smaller upfront investment. Companies ready to invest in a dedicated, skilled team may find greater long-term value in-house.

Operational Bandwidth: If your current staff is already stretched thin, adding SEO responsibilities risks burnout. Outsourcing lets the organization stay focused on core competencies while experts handle SEO.

Expertise and Strategy Needs: Advanced SEO tactics often call for an established agency’s expertise. An in-house team can shine when SEO goals are closely tied to broader business objectives, given their contextual and competitive knowledge.

Guidance on Determining the Best Option for a Business

A well-rounded evaluation starts with aligning business goals to the chosen SEO approach, and considering hybrid models that blend in-house and outsourced elements.

Hybrid Models: Some organizations keep core SEO staff in-house while outsourcing specialized tasks like analytics or technical SEO—maintaining brand alignment while still benefiting from outside expertise.

What Are the Key Differences Between Outsourcing SEO Services and Building an In-House SEO Team?

The key differences come down to roles, responsibilities, and workflow. Outsourced teams typically bring defined roles—SEO strategists, content creators, technical experts—while in-house teams often require broader skill sets, with employees wearing multiple hats in smaller companies.

Common challenges include misjudging internal capabilities, underestimating SEO’s complexity, and friction from communication lags or inconsistent quality. Aligning your chosen approach with long-term marketing goals is critical either way.

What Are the Benefits and Drawbacks of Outsourcing SEO for Growth-Stage Companies?

Benefits:

  1. Rapid Implementation: Agencies can move quickly, improving visibility sooner.
  2. Cost Savings: Avoids the expense of recruiting and training full-time staff.
  3. Expanded Skill Base: Exposure to emerging tactics and industry best practices.

Drawbacks:

  1. Lack of Brand Understanding: Agencies may not fully grasp your messaging or ethos.
  2. Dependency on External Partners: Creates vulnerability if the relationship falters.
  3. Quality Variability: Growth-stage companies may struggle to attract top-tier agencies.

How Does Outsourcing SEO Enhance Scalability and Flexibility?

Outsourcing lets businesses adapt quickly to changing market conditions, since agencies can expand or contract resources as needs shift—allowing companies to pivot strategy quickly when opportunities arise, and scale back just as easily when they don’t.

What Are the Common Risks and Limitations of SEO Outsourcing?

Finding a reputable agency that aligns with your objectives takes thorough vetting. Companies must also guard against over-reliance on external partners, keeping enough internal knowledge to withstand disruptions in service or changes in agency partnerships.

How Does an In-House SEO Team Compare in Terms of Cost, Skills, and Performance?

Cost: Total cost includes salaries, benefits, training, and tools—keeping overhead low is especially important for smaller firms.

Skills: In-house teams need a broad range of technical SEO and content strategy skills, making ongoing training and recruitment essential for retaining talent.

Performance: Measured through organic traffic growth, keyword ranking improvements, and conversion rate optimization, with regular reviews keeping the team attuned to results.

What Budget and Resources Are Needed to Build and Manage an Effective SEO Team Internally?

Key resources include technical optimization tools, analytics platforms, and ongoing training programs. Budgeting should cover hiring, tool subscriptions, and training, with regular reviews to adapt as SEO needs evolve.

How Do Performance Outcomes of In-House SEO Teams Typically Measure Up?

In-house teams tend to perform well when properly resourced and supported by company culture. Success is measured through KPIs like organic traffic growth, lead generation, and conversions, with continuous adaptation to changing algorithms and user behavior essential for sustained results.

What Is White Label SEO and How Does It Support Agencies Serving Growth-Stage Companies?

White label SEO is a service where an agency provides SEO solutions that another company can rebrand as its own—letting agencies expand their offerings without building new capabilities internally.

Benefits: Immediate access to expert resources, and the ability to focus internal efforts on core services.

Considerations: Agencies should vet white label providers for compatibility with existing strategies and alignment with brand values to avoid messaging conflicts.

How Do White Label SEO Services Enable Agencies to Expand Their Marketing Offerings?

White label services let agencies diversify—offering content creation, analytics reporting, and technical SEO under one umbrella. This fuller engagement can also improve client retention through more consistent communication and relationship-building.

What Factors Should Agencies Consider When Selecting White Label SEO Providers?

Look for a provider whose expertise and operational model fit your existing services, along with a solid reputation and proven track record. Due diligence during partner selection pays off over the long run.

How Do Outsourcing SEO Costs Compare to Maintaining an In-House SEO Team?

Outsourcing costs are typically structured as monthly retainers or project fees tied to specific services. In-house costs are fixed—salaries, recruitment, and tools—requiring careful ongoing management to stay viable.

How Can Companies Evaluate SEO ROI Across Outsourcing and In-House Models?

Track organic traffic, lead generation, and conversions for quantitative performance, and pair that with qualitative feedback—customer satisfaction and client ratings—to gauge overall SEO effectiveness regardless of approach.

How Should Companies Decide Between Outsourcing SEO Services and Building an In-House Team?

The right choice comes down to evaluating your unique business needs, preferences, and resources—aligning the decision with overarching business goals, financial implications, operational capacity, and long-term growth aspirations.

What Key Criteria Help Determine the Best SEO Service Model for Your Business Needs?

Business Size and Industry: Different sizes and industries call for different models.

Resource Availability: Existing expertise and operational bandwidth clarify whether an agency’s specialized skills are necessary or an in-house approach will suffice.

Future Growth Plans: Rapid expansion may call for the flexibility outsourcing offers, while a focus on sustainable growth may favor building in-house.

How Can Agencies and Growth-Stage Companies Align SEO Choices with Long-Term Marketing Goals?

Aligning SEO strategy with broader marketing objectives keeps messaging and branding cohesive. Effective collaboration between marketing and SEO teams—whether in-house or outsourced—drives growth and strengthens market competitiveness.
